The General Manager position at McAlister's Deli located in Sugar Land, TX, is a pivotal leadership role responsible for overseeing all facets of restaurant operations to ensure exceptional guest experiences and operational excellence. This full-time career opportunity offers a competitive compensation package along with eligibility for performance bonuses, reflecting the company's recognition of hard work and dedication. The General Manager leads by example in maintaining safety standards, quality control, and compliance with company policies. Managing daily operations such as scheduling, maintaining cleanliness, and service excellence are integral parts of the role. Effective leadership skills are necessary to motivate and develop team members, control costs, and drive continuous improvement that boosts both guest satisfaction and profitability.

This role requires hands-on management with a focus on cultivating a positive and inviting atmosphere, both for guests and employees. The General Manager is key to fostering a workplace that supports innovation and employee advancement, offering paid training, complementary meals while on duty, and access to daily pay through an earned wage app. McAlister's also provides robust benefits, including 401K options, HSA, medical, dental, vision, disability, and life insurance plans, as well as mileage care allowances to support the well-being of its associates and their families. Opportunities for career advancement exist within the company, making this role ideal for individuals seeking to build a long-term career in hospitality management while becoming part of a team that values genuine hospitality and shared success.

Job Requirements

  • minimum of 2 years current experience in the casual restaurant industry
  • previous experience in deli or food service management preferred
  • experience in hotel catering coffee service banquet operations assistant management food production or bartending is a plus
  • high school diploma or GED required
  • associate’s or bachelor’s degree preferred
  • servsafe license preferred or able to obtain a state-approved license must be maintained per state mandates
  • availability to work within open hours including evenings holidays weekends
  • ability to multitask and pr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ment
  • maintain a well-groomed appearance and follow uniform standards
  • display a positive and outwardly friendly attitude towards all guests
  • exceptional written and verbal communication skills
  • able to withstand the physical demands a restaurant environment holds

Job Duties

  • oversee daily restaurant operations ensuring safety quality and compliance
  • lead scheduling and maintain high levels of cleanliness and service
  • guide and develop team members to foster a positive and productive work environment
  • control costs and implement operational improvements
  • deliver exceptional guest experiences through superior customer service
  • manage inventory and protect company assets
  • make daily operational decisions to drive restaurant success
